The 319 line is essentially a fragrance free version of the 613 line... or as Chaz refers to the 613 line: Wen on steroids. Smiley Happy

 

Because of this, the 613 CC (and 319 CC) are more concentrated... so you don't use as many pumps of CC to cleanse your hair as you would for the other lines. -- It may simply be that you are using too many pumps of 319 CC... so if you just took your normal amount of time to wash the excess CC off your hair, then that simply might have not been enough time to get it all off. 

 

You may want to read the number of pumps recommendations which are on the back of the 319 CC bottle... and then cut back the number of pumps accordingly. Smiley Happy

I cleanse well , rinse and cleanse the second time leaving the cleanser in while I take the balance of my shower.   I then rinse completely and put the small amount of cleanser and styling creme into my soaking wet hair.  I make sure that I clean with the correct amount of cleanser each time needed for my hair length.   At first I used to much and it just washed down the drain.  When I did not use enough each time my hair did not come out right.   It took me a few times to get it right.  Occasionally I watch the infomercials and on the Q to keep up on any new information that I might have missed..  Now that I have learned what my hair needs I could wash only 1 time per week.  I usually wash 2-3 times so that I can do the treatments oils,etc.  With my electric air heat and cold winds this winter my scalp had a tendency to get dry if I did not do the oils.  I love the WEN products and have found that because I cleanse so seldom it really does not cost me much more than what I spent before and my hair is now healthy.  Before WEN I had to wash and set every day using shampoo, conditioner, hairspray, etc.  My hair is baby fine and straight as an arrow.  It has been that way all of my life.  My beautician of 25+ years is amazed and says my hair is in the best shape she has ever seen it. For the first time in my life my hair is healthy and it needs to be trimmed 5-6 weeks to keep it at about my shoulder blades.  I rotate all of the cleansers having about 4 going at one time just for the scents.
